Netflix has picked up the rights to make a sequel to "Beverly Hills Cop", with Eddie Murphy set to star and Jerry Bruckheimer set to produce.
It's a one-time licensing deal between Netflix and Paramount to produce the latest reboot of the "Beverly Hills Cop" franchise. Adil El Arbi and Bilall Fallah are on board to direct the long-awaited fourth installment of the series.
The first three Beverly Hills Cop films were released in 1984, 1987, and 1994, respectively, and earned a total of $735.5 million worldwide.
